SalvAIoT: Intelligent AIoT System for Prevention and Support in Mountain Search and Rescue Operations
SalvAIoT is a multidisciplinary research project focused on developing an innovative AIoT (Artificial Intelligence of Things) system aimed at preventing mountain accidents and supporting Search and Rescue (SAR) operations. The system integrates wearable devices, fixed trail nodes, drones, LPWAN technologies (LoRa and NB-IoT), and TinyML algorithms to detect trail deviations and localize victims efficiently under real-world conditions with minimal energy and processing requirements.
Project Objectives
- Define the use cases, system architecture, and component specifications of the SalvAIoT platform.
- Design and develop mobile user devices (DMU) and trail marker devices (DMT) equipped with GPS, acoustic sensors, accelerometers, and LPWAN modules (LoRa/NB-IoT).
- Create a drone-mounted localization module (MLOC) for real-time victim detection using voice and LoRa/NB-IoT signals.
- Implement and validate TinyML algorithms for trail deviation detection and voice-based localization on embedded hardware.
- Integrate all hardware and software modules into the final SalvAIoT system and test in real mountain scenarios.

Consortium and Partners
The project is coordinated by the Faculty of Electronics, Telecommunications and Information Technology, National University of Science and Technology Politehnica Bucharest (UPB)

Implementation Timeline
Start Date: October 09, 2023
End Date: December 31, 2025
Funding
Funded through a program of the National Alliance of Technical Universities (ARUT).
Total budget: €10,000

Expected Outcomes
- Fully integrated AIoT system for mountain accident prevention and SAR support
- TinyML models for deviation detection and victim voice localization
- Custom datasets with LoRa/NB-IoT signal measurements and voice samples
- Scientific publications, technical reports, and a potential patented solution
